The global vagus nerve stimulation (VNS) market is poised for remarkable growth, driven by the rising prevalence of neurological disorders, technological advancements, and the growing shift towards minimally invasive neuromodulation therapies. The global vagus nerve stimulation (VNS) market is on a strong upward trajectory, projected to grow from US$ 562.3 million in 2025 to US$ 996.5 million by 2032, reflecting a robust CAGR of 8.52% during the forecast period. VNS therapy has emerged as a promising treatment for individuals resistant to conventional treatments for conditions such as epilepsy, depression, and migraine. The increasing focus on non-pharmacological treatment alternatives and the integration of digital health technologies is further propelling the industry forward.

Market Insights
The vagus nerve, a key component of the autonomic nervous system, plays a crucial role in controlling several physiological processes. VNS devices function by delivering electrical impulses to this nerve, which helps regulate abnormalities in neural activity. The market is evolving rapidly, with implantable and external VNS devices becoming increasingly popular for their efficacy in managing complex neurological conditions.With significant innovations in the design and application of these devices, healthcare practitioners are now able to offer more tailored and effective treatment plans. The ongoing development of closed-loop systems and AI-based tools is enhancing both the accuracy and adaptability of VNS therapy.

Recent Developments
Recent industry activity underscores the dynamic nature of the VNS market. A prominent innovation was the introduction of a dual-pin implantable pulse generator designed to enhance the delivery of VNS therapy for epilepsy. Another firm launched a new non-invasive wellness product tailored for everyday stress management and mental well-being. Such developments illustrate the ongoing diversification and application of VNS across both clinical and consumer wellness markets.Challenges and Restraints

The future of the VNS market lies in expanding its therapeutic reach, enhancing patient access, and further integrating smart technologies. Research continues to explore VNS applications beyond epilepsy and depression, including conditions like chronic heart failure, obesity, and inflammatory disorders.As regulatory bodies provide clearer pathways for approval and insurance providers expand coverage, the market is expected to see sustained momentum.
